Item 5.02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ers.  

 

On April 20, 2016, the stockholders of ORBCOMM Inc. (the “Company”) approved the ORBCOMM Inc. 2016 Long-Term Incentives Plan (the “2016 LTIP”), as described in the Company’s proxy statement dated March 18, 2016 for the Company’s 2016 Annual Meeting of Shareholders. The Board of Directors adopted the 2016 LTIP on February 17, 2016, subject to approval by the Company’s stockholders at the 2016 Annual Meeting. The 2016 LTIP replaces the Company’s 2006 Long-Term Incentives Plan, as amended (the “2006 LTIP”), which was due to expire in September 2016.  Upon approval of the 2016 LTIP by stockholders, no further awards will be made under the 2006 LTIP.

 

The 2016 LTIP permits the grant of a variety of awards to employees (including named executive officers), prospective employees and non-employee directors, including stock options, stock appreciation rights, stock, restricted stock, restricted stock units, performance units, performance shares and cash awards. The number of shares authorized for delivery under the 2016 LTIP is 6,949,400 shares, including 1,949,400 shares that remained available under the 2006 LTIP as of February 17, 2016.

 

The foregoing description of the 2016 LTIP is not complete and is qualified in its entirety by reference to the 2016 LTIP, a copy of which is included as Exhibit 99.1 and is incorporated herein by reference.
